Von Mises stress and stability analysis of wellbore wall under non-uniform in-situ stress

  • In order to analyze the influence of Von Mises stress on the borehole wall under non-uniform insitu stress and its effect on the stability of the borehole wall, a mechanical analysis model of the rock near the wellbore wall under non-uniform in-situ stress was established. According to the relationship between stress and stress function in elastic mechanics, based on the superposition principles, the formulas of radial stress,circumferential stress and shear stress are derived, the influence of non-uniform in-situ stress on wellbore wall stability is analyzed, the quadratic fitting formula of the Von Mises stress on the wellbore wall with the density of drilling fluid as the independent variable is determined. The error of Von Mises stress calculated by the fitting formula is less than 2.5%, and this formula can be used to determine the density of drilling fluid in the wellbore wall rock without fractures.
